Compact molding programs with a clamping unit that operates vertically are employed to provide plastic elements. This configuration typically incorporates a rotary desk or shuttle system facilitating insert loading and half removing. The orientation permits gravity to help partly ejection, notably useful for intricate or self-tapping inserts. A typical software includes molding digital connectors with embedded metallic contacts.
These specialised machines excel in purposes requiring insert molding, overmolding, and producing elements with complicated geometries. Their smaller footprint in comparison with horizontal counterparts makes them enticing for services with restricted area. The vertical clamping orientation contributes to enhanced operator ergonomics and quicker cycle instances resulting from environment friendly materials stream and insert placement.
